habían desembarazado
-they/you had cleared
Past perfectellos/ellas/ustedesconjugation ofdesembarazar.

desembarazar

Los hombres de la aldea se habían reunido y se habían desembarazado de el con lanzas, algo que había alegrado mucho al magistrado Shinjo.
The men of the village had gathered together and dispatched it with spears, which had pleased the Shinjo magistrate greatly.
Word of the Day
riddle